Generating Buzz For Your Law Firm

from Crushing Chaos with Law Firm Mentor · host Allison C Williams, Esq.

Amanda Berlin believes she was born to make sure we all are heard and seen and appreciated for our unique genius. And she does just that as a publicity strategist and content consultant. After studying journalism at George Washington University, she interned at CNN, wrote for a local paper, and ultimately became an expert in the creation of publicity strategy and content writing products and programs. For a decade, she has written media pitches for companies like Disney and Dove, Brawney, Baskin Robbins, Colgate and Gamble. And now as a communications consultant, she's the host of the Empowered Publicity Podcast, which is devoted to delivering publicity, AHA's insider secrets and the dish on what it really takes to build buzz, become a trusted authority and get the media to say yes.   In this episode we discuss: The term public relations and what that encompasses. Honing your story for the public to hear and get to know you. The perceived boundaries between being professional versus being personal. How a powerful story is memorable and can set you apart in the marketplace. The importance of mindset in achieving what we desire. Key roadblocks that hinder the effort to seek publicity. Getting past the tendency toward over-preparation. Preparing your story and tailoring your message to your audience and goals.
